Umno polls: Asyraf, Noraini and Zahida announced as new wings leaders


KUALA LUMPUR: It's official! The Umno Youth chief is Datuk Dr Asyraf Wajdi Dusuki, the Wanita chief is Datuk Dr Noraini Ahmad and the Puteri chief is Datuk Zahida Zarik Khan.

The official results of the Umno wings' elections was announced by Umno executive secretary Datuk Seri Ab Rauf Yusoh at Umno's headquarters at Putra World Trade Centre (PWTC), 9pm on Sunday (June 24) after a delay of more than four hours.

Umno veteran Tengku Razaleigh Hamzah, who is contesting for the president post, told Bernama on Sunday that he was happy that all the candidates he supported had won, based on unofficial results at the time.

"God willing, this will give new breath to the party," he said.

Umno vice-president Datuk Seri Dr Ahmad Zahid Hamidi, who is also a candidate for the president post, congratulated the trio on Sunday in a Facebook post before the official results were announced.

He aligned himself with the new wings' chiefs by posting a poster of himself with the faces of Dr Asyraf, Dr Noraini and Zahida with the message: "Together, let us rise up in the name of Umno and continue to strengthen and align Umno with the hearts of Malaysians, especially the Malays".
